I have a Hisense U6GR that is just under 2 months old. At first it would auto detect when I would turn on my Series X/PS5/Switch and the tv would automatically switch to that input. It suddenly stopped doing this and Hisense says this is a Roku operating system problem.
Enable 1 touch play found under settings/ system/ control other devices (cec)
